Skip to content

Commit

Permalink
parameterized field base camp ver 1 (#64304)
Browse files Browse the repository at this point in the history
* parameterized field base camp ver 1

* second formatter path with tool gets files missed by first try

---------

Co-authored-by: Kevin Granade <[email protected]>
Co-authored-by: Maleclypse <[email protected]>
  • Loading branch information
3 people authored Jun 15, 2023
1 parent a8d4ad8 commit 8ca6930
Show file tree
Hide file tree
Showing 28 changed files with 1,752 additions and 6,007 deletions.
49 changes: 8 additions & 41 deletions .github/vcpkg_ports/sdl2/vcpkg.json
Original file line number Diff line number Diff line change
Expand Up @@ -5,54 +5,21 @@
"homepage": "https://www.libsdl.org/download-2.0.php",
"license": "Zlib",
"dependencies": [
{
"name": "vcpkg-cmake",
"host": true
},
{
"name": "vcpkg-cmake-config",
"host": true
}
{ "name": "vcpkg-cmake", "host": true },
{ "name": "vcpkg-cmake-config", "host": true }
],
"default-features": [
"base"
],
"features": {
"base": {
"description": "Base functionality for SDL",
"dependencies": [
{
"name": "sdl2",
"default-features": false,
"features": [
"ibus",
"wayland",
"x11"
],
"platform": "linux"
}
]
},
"ibus": {
"description": "Build with ibus IME support",
"supports": "linux"
},
"samplerate": {
"description": "Use libsamplerate for audio rate conversion",
"dependencies": [
"libsamplerate"
]
},
"vulkan": {
"description": "Vulkan functionality for SDL"
},
"wayland": {
"description": "Build with Wayland support",
"supports": "linux"
"dependencies": [ { "name": "sdl2", "default-features": false, "features": [ "ibus", "wayland", "x11" ], "platform": "linux" } ]
},
"x11": {
"description": "Build with X11 support",
"supports": "!windows"
}
"ibus": { "description": "Build with ibus IME support", "supports": "linux" },
"samplerate": { "description": "Use libsamplerate for audio rate conversion", "dependencies": [ "libsamplerate" ] },
"vulkan": { "description": "Vulkan functionality for SDL" },
"wayland": { "description": "Build with Wayland support", "supports": "linux" },
"x11": { "description": "Build with X11 support", "supports": "!windows" }
}
}
38 changes: 16 additions & 22 deletions build-scripts/problem-matchers/catch2.json
Original file line number Diff line number Diff line change
@@ -1,25 +1,19 @@
{
"problemMatcher": [
"problemMatcher": [
{
"owner": "cata-catch2",
"pattern": [
{
"owner": "cata-catch2",
"pattern": [
{
"reg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(?:\\.\\./)*([^:]*):(\\d+): .*FAILED:.*$",
"file": 1,
"line": 2
},
{
"reg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(.+)$",
"code": 1
},
{
"reg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(with expansion|due to a fatal error condition):$"
},
{
"reg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(.+)$",
"message": 1
}
]
}
]
"reg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(?:\\.\\./)*([^:]*):(\\d+): .*FAILED:.*$",
"file": 1,
"line": 2
},
{ "reg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(.+)$", "code": 1 },
{
"reg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(with expansion|due to a fatal error condition):$"
},
{ "regexp": "(?:\\(.*\\)=>[\\s\\t]*)(?:.\\[[0-9;]+m)*[\\s\\t]*(.+)$", "message": 1 }
]
}
]
}
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_log_palette" ]
"palettes": [ "fbmh_0_log_palette" ]
}
},
{
Expand All @@ -30,7 +30,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_metal_palette" ]
"palettes": [ "fbmh_0_metal_palette" ]
}
},
{
Expand All @@ -47,7 +47,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_migo_resin_palette" ]
"palettes": [ "fbmh_0_migo_resin_palette" ]
}
},
{
Expand All @@ -64,7 +64,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_rammed_earth_palette" ]
"palettes": [ "fbmh_0_rammed_earth_palette" ]
}
},
{
Expand All @@ -81,7 +81,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_rock_palette" ]
"palettes": [ "fbmh_0_rock_palette" ]
}
},
{
Expand All @@ -98,7 +98,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_wad_palette" ]
"palettes": [ "fbmh_0_wad_palette" ]
}
},
{
Expand All @@ -115,7 +115,7 @@
"w.... ",
"wwwww "
],
"palettes": [ "fbmh_wood_palette" ]
"palettes": [ "fbmh_0_wood_palette" ]
}
},
{
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@
"w ...w",
"ww+vww"
],
"palettes": [ "fbmh_migo_resin_palette" ]
"palettes": [ "fbmh_0_migo_resin_palette" ]
}
},
{
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@
"w ...w",
"ww+vww"
],
"palettes": [ "fbmh_wood_palette" ]
"palettes": [ "fbmh_0_wood_palette" ]
}
},
{
Expand Down
Loading

0 comments on commit 8ca6930

Please sign in to comment.